Abstract

Fiadeiro and Veronis (1977) use a weighted mean scheme to develop a finite difference approximation to advection-diffusion type partial differential equations. The resulting numerical approximation tends to a centered difference formulation for strongly diffusive cases and to an upstream formulation for strongly advective cases. A simpler alternative derivation of their scheme is presented here which clarifies its basis. Using the new approach, the extension to a spatially variable grid and a similar scheme based on average cell properties are obtained. Errors associated with temporal variations are discussed and a stability criterion appropriate to forward differencing in time is presented.
